Output d8666b8d140e5ac88bbacb2bde6110fe7ffc94f234586fdb6e434a954a8e415e:0

value
131750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adcb404e67718f151b2d0c5d3c297629cf67e904 OP_EQUAL
address
3HXxJsUgyB27foZ5ZxkE2PLDQWij1qa44S
transaction
d8666b8d140e5ac88bbacb2bde6110fe7ffc94f234586fdb6e434a954a8e415e